Bike Stems Buying Guide
Bike stems connect the handlebar to the steerer tube. They affect reach, handlebar height and steering feel, so size compatibility should always come before colour or style.
Check the handlebar clamp size
The handlebar clamp size must match your handlebar. This category includes stems for 31.8mm handlebars and adjustable high-rise stems in 25.4mm and 31.8mm options.
Short MTB stems
Short mountain bike stems can bring the handlebar closer to the rider. This may suit MTB setups where a shorter reach or quicker steering feel is wanted.
Adjustable high-rise stems
Adjustable stems allow the handlebar angle to change. The high-rise options in this category can help lift the handlebar position, which may improve comfort for some riders.
Stem length matters
Stem length changes the distance between the rider and the handlebar. A shorter stem can feel more direct, while a longer stem usually gives a more stretched riding position.
Check before buying
- Check your current handlebar clamp size.
- Check your steerer tube compatibility.
- Choose a length that suits your riding position.
- Allow enough cable length when raising the handlebar.
- Tighten all bolts evenly before riding.
